World Meteorological Organization: "The UN Bangkok Climate Change Talks mapped out a work programme that structures negotiations on a long-term international climate change agreement, set to be concluded in Copenhagen by the end of 2009. The meeting also sent a clear signal that the use of market-based mechanisms, such as the Kyoto Protocol's Clean Development Mechanism, should be continued and improved as a way for developed countries to meet emission reduction targets and contribute towards sustainable development."
